The concept for Northern Freegold Resources Ltd. began during the bear market in junior mining of the 1990's and focused on the Mt. Freegold area of south-central Yukon. Management was able to take advantage of these conditions by assembling a very impressive land package (64 square miles) by way of property acquisition and consolidation. The Freegold Mountain Project, includes a number of mineralized zones that host established inferred resources totaling 700,000 ounces of gold (N43-101 report). Known gold occurrences (in excess of 15) within this project provide the opportunity to expand this resource plus an excellent environment for new discoveries. The Burro Creek Property is located 1.6 km off State Highway 93 in Mohave County, Arizona. The Property covers a low-sulphidation epithermal vein system that has been traced for over 1.7 km and exhibits widths of up to 45 metres. Previous exploration on the property has focused on a 300 metre strike length in the central block of the exposed vein system and outlined a historical gold and silver resource of 2.6 million tons with an average grade of 0.03 oz gold and 1.1 oz silver per ton.
